如何通过运维可观测性提高服务质量?

在当今数字化时代,服务质量对于企业的重要性不言而喻。然而,如何提高服务质量,成为许多企业面临的一大挑战。其中,运维可观测性作为一种重要的技术手段,能够帮助企业实现这一目标。本文将深入探讨如何通过运维可观测性提高服务质量,以期为相关企业提供有益的参考。

一、什么是运维可观测性?

运维可观测性(Observability)是指对系统运行状态、性能、健康状况的全面了解和感知。通过运维可观测性,企业可以实时掌握系统运行情况,及时发现并解决问题,从而提高服务质量。

二、运维可观测性如何提高服务质量?

  1. 实时监控

实时监控是运维可观测性的核心功能之一。通过实时监控系统运行状态,企业可以及时发现潜在问题,避免故障扩大,从而保证服务质量。以下是一些常见的实时监控方法:

  • 日志分析:通过对系统日志进行分析,可以了解系统运行过程中的异常情况,为问题排查提供线索。
  • 性能监控:通过监控CPU、内存、磁盘等关键性能指标,可以及时发现系统瓶颈,优化资源配置。
  • 网络监控:实时监控网络流量,可以了解网络状况,及时发现网络故障。

  1. 自动化告警

自动化告警是运维可观测性的另一重要功能。通过设置告警阈值,当系统运行状态超过预设范围时,系统会自动发出告警,提醒运维人员及时处理。以下是一些常见的自动化告警场景:

  • 系统资源使用率过高:当CPU、内存、磁盘等资源使用率超过预设阈值时,系统会发出告警。
  • 网络故障:当网络出现异常时,系统会发出告警。
  • 应用异常:当应用出现错误或异常时,系统会发出告警。

  1. 故障排查

故障排查是运维可观测性的关键环节。通过分析系统日志、性能数据、网络数据等,可以快速定位故障原因,并采取相应措施解决问题。以下是一些故障排查方法:

  • 故障定位:通过分析系统日志、性能数据、网络数据等,确定故障发生的位置。
  • 故障分析:分析故障原因,找出导致故障的根本原因。
  • 故障修复:根据故障原因,采取相应措施修复故障。

  1. 持续优化

持续优化是运维可观测性的最终目标。通过不断收集和分析系统运行数据,可以优化系统架构、调整资源配置,提高系统性能,从而提升服务质量。

三、案例分析

以下是一个企业通过运维可观测性提高服务质量的案例:

某企业拥有一套复杂的IT系统,包括多个应用、数据库、网络设备等。由于系统复杂,故障频发,导致服务质量低下。为了提高服务质量,企业决定引入运维可观测性技术。

首先,企业通过日志分析、性能监控、网络监控等手段,实时掌握系统运行状态。当系统出现异常时,系统会自动发出告警,提醒运维人员及时处理。

其次,企业通过故障排查,快速定位故障原因,并采取相应措施解决问题。经过一段时间的努力,企业成功降低了故障发生率,提高了服务质量。

四、总结

运维可观测性作为一种重要的技术手段,能够帮助企业提高服务质量。通过实时监控、自动化告警、故障排查、持续优化等手段,企业可以及时发现并解决问题,从而保证系统稳定运行,提升用户满意度。

猜你喜欢:根因分析